数据库中以0开头的数据在excel中开头的0直接忽略了 而且很大的数字是以指数形式表示的 怎样才能让excel不忽略开头的0 并且大数也以串的形式保存 网上找了下 方法是在Format.php中getXf($style)中加一行 if($ifmt == '0') $ifmt = 1; 按这个做 他的NumberFormat.php中定义的const FORMAT_NUMBER= '0'; 好像还是没有作用 有什么办法么?
excel 中,如果需要输入的文本,在其上方的单元格中已经输入过,可以用下面两种方法来快速重复输入: 方法一:选中单元格后按“Alt+↓”组合键,即可 打开 一个列表,然后通过方向键 选择 输入即可。 方法二: 鼠标右键 单击需要输入数据的单元格,在随后弹出的快捷菜单中,选择“从 下拉列表 中选择”选项,打开上面数据列表,选择输入就行了。 注意: 以上两种方法所建立的列表数据,建立到上方出现空白行为止...
往excel里写东西,中文老是乱码。 use Unicode::Map(); my $Map = new Unicode::Map("GB2312"); $worksheet->write_unicode(2, 2, $Map->to_unicode("考生姓名")); 上面这段是网上的代码,在linux环境下单元格里是个小格子,乱码,但把这个excel导入到windows下面能正常显示。 我照着上面的那段代码写了自己的程序 #!usr/local/perl5/bin/perl use Spreadsheet::Writeexcel; use Unicode::Map(); my $Map=new Unicode::Map("G...
我用perl变了一段程序,能够从mysql里导出数据存为一个excel表,但是里面的中文全部是乱码,求救啊!!!!!! 谁知道这个怎么弄就教教我吧,因为这个都郁闷好几天了!
平常我们用PHP生成excel大都是如下代码: ob_start(); header("Content-type:application/vnd.ms-excel"); header("Content-Disposition:filename=report.xls"); echo "公司名称\t公司地址\t公司电话"; echo "西部硅谷\t西安市雁塔中路段26号\t029-85512287"; echo "西部硅谷\t西安市雁塔中路段26号\t029-85512287"; echo "西部硅谷\t西安市雁塔中路段26号\t029-85512287"; 但如果要在单元格内换行的话,可能不太好弄,一般换...
谁知道Spreadsheet_excel_Writer如何合并单元格,并向这个合并的格子里写东西. 另外谁有Spreadsheet_excel_Writer的说明书啊,http://pear.php.net的那个好象只有太简单的介绍,谁有详细点的呢